阿里云上线 Moltbot (原 Clawdbot) 全套云服务,助力 Agent 应用

阿里云上线Moltbot全套云服务,提供Agent应用所需的算力、模型和消息应用支持,简化部署流程,并支持多种消息通道。

原文标题:刚刚,阿里云上线 Clawdbot 全套云服务!

原文作者:阿里云开发者

冷月清谈:

阿里云正式推出Moltbot全套云服务,为Agent应用提供所需的算力、模型和消息应用支持。用户可以在阿里云轻量应用服务器或无影云电脑上快速启用Moltbot,并调用百炼平台上的千问系列模型。Moltbot支持iMessage消息应用,并能通过阿里云计算巢实现钉钉消息互动。文章还提供了在轻量应用服务器上部署Moltbot的具体步骤,包括选择Moltbot镜像、配置百炼API Key、放行端口以及生成访问Token。此外,阿里云无影云电脑也提供内置Moltbot的专属镜像,预装常用开发工具和办公软件,方便用户快速启动。

怜星夜思:

1、Moltbot集成了阿里云百炼的千问系列模型,这对Agent应用开发者来说意味着什么?除了千问模型,未来Moltbot是否有可能支持其他大模型平台?
2、文章提到了Moltbot可以部署在轻量应用服务器和无影云电脑上,这两种部署方式有什么区别?应该如何根据自身的需求进行选择?
3、Moltbot目前支持iMessage和钉钉消息互动,未来在消息通道上还有哪些扩展的可能性?例如,是否可以集成微信或者其他社交平台?

原文内容

刚刚,阿里云正式上线Moltbot(原名:Clawdbot)全套云服务,全面提供Agent所需的算力、模型和消息应用等。

用户可在阿里云轻量应用服务器或无影云电脑上快速启用Moltbot,并按需调用阿里云百炼上一百多款千问系列模型,在消息通道上,该方案不仅支持iMessage消息应用,还能基于阿里云计算巢实现钉钉消息互动。


云服务器部署教程如下👇


// 第一步:打开轻量应用服务器并安装Moltbot镜像


打开轻量服务器,点击「应用镜像」,选择「Moltbot」


// 第二步:配置Moltbot


1. 前往百炼大模型控制台,找到密钥管理,单击创建API-Key


2. 前往轻量应用服务器控制台,找到安装好Moltbot的实例,进入 「应用详情」 放行18789端口、配置百炼API Key、执行命令,生成访问Moltbot的Token。



a. 端口放通:需要放通对应端口的防火墙,单击一键放通即可。

b. 配置百炼API Key,单击一键配置,输入百炼的API-Key。单击执行命令,写入API Key。

c. 配置Moltbot:单击执行命令,生成访问Moltbot的Token。

d. 访问控制页面:单击打开网站页面可进入Moltbot对话页面。


此外,阿里云无影云电脑也已上线内置Moltbot和各种应用软件的专属镜像,预装了包括VS Code、TMUX、钉钉、WPS等组件,并支持钉钉、QQ等软件唤醒Moltbot,只需一键导入镜像即可启动。 


/ END /


点击阅读原文,立即部署!


从安全角度考虑,使用计算巢可以将 Moltbot 部署在阿里云的 VPC 环境中,与钉钉应用进行隔离,避免了数据泄露的风险。而且,计算巢还提供了访问控制和审计功能,可以提高整体安全性,并且计算巢部署可以一键完成,无需关心底层服务。

问题:文章提到阿里云百炼上一百多款千问系列模型,开发者应该如何选择适合自己的模型?

我觉得阿里云应该提供更详细的模型介绍和对比评测,比如每个模型的适用场景、性能指标、API调用方式等等。如果能有一个类似于模型推荐的功能,根据开发者的需求自动推荐合适的模型,那就更好了。

问题:文章提到阿里云百炼上一百多款千问系列模型,开发者应该如何选择适合自己的模型?

选择模型时,除了考虑模型的性能和功能,还要考虑模型的成本。不同的模型,API调用费用可能不一样。对于一些小规模的应用,可以选择一些性价比高的模型,避免不必要的成本开销。可以关注阿里云百炼的价格政策,选择最经济的模型方案。

从炼丹师的角度说两句,选模型这事儿没有银弹。我的建议是小范围POC验证,根据实际效果说话。可以先选几个看起来相关的模型,用小批量数据跑一下,看看哪个效果最好,然后再针对性地调优。别怕麻烦,多试错才能找到最适合你的模型。

我倾向于从以下几个方面考虑:一是模型的专业领域,例如,擅长金融领域的模型在处理金融相关的任务时效果更好。二是模型的规模和复杂度,更大的模型通常效果更好,但也需要更多的计算资源。三是模型的训练数据,确保模型使用的数据与你的应用场景相匹配。最后,可以考虑使用AutoML工具,自动选择和优化模型,从而找到最合适的选择。

我认为轻量应用服务器的优势在于成本可控,可以根据实际使用情况灵活调整配置。无影云电脑的优势在于便捷性,无需自己搭建环境,适合快速部署和测试。如果长期使用,并且对性能有较高要求,轻量应用服务器更划算。如果只是短期体验或者对便捷性要求更高,无影云电脑更适合。

我觉得以后Agent在消息应用里可以做的事情太多了!比如智能客服,能真正听懂用户的问题,还能个性化推荐;还有智能助手,能帮你管理日程、预定酒店、处理邮件,简直是高效神器。甚至还能开发一些娱乐型的Agent,比如陪你聊天、玩游戏,缓解压力。

我觉得 Agent 应用最大的特点是“自主 + 智能”。以前的应用是被动地等待用户指令,现在的 Agent 可以主动感知用户需求,根据环境变化智能地进行调整。但这样是不是对开发者的要求更高了?不仅要考虑功能实现,还要考虑 Agent 的智能程度和自主性。

我觉得未来的 Agent 应用,消息互动肯定不止于 iMessage 和钉钉。可以想象一下,以后 Agent 可以直接在微信、飞书、企业微信等各种平台上与用户互动,真正实现“无处不在”的服务。甚至可以根据用户的喜好,选择不同的消息通道,比如喜欢用邮件的就通过邮件,喜欢用短信的就通过短信。

对于需要大量算力的开发者来说,无影云电脑 + Agent 是一个不错的选择。比如 AI 算法工程师,可以在云电脑上快速部署 Agent,进行模型训练和测试,省去了本地电脑配置的麻烦。而且云电脑的算力可以弹性扩展,满足不同阶段的需求。

这简直就是 Agent 的社交牛逼症啊!能随时随地跟人聊天才是王道。你想想,如果 Agent 只能在一个平台上用,那得错过多少机会啊!说不定还能成为新的社交入口呢(滑稽

个人感觉,Moltbot的优势在于与阿里云生态的深度整合,尤其是与百炼平台的结合,使得模型调用和管理更加便捷。但劣势也明显,就是受限于阿里云生态,不够开放。它可能会吸引一部分企业用户,但对于追求灵活性的独立开发者,可能吸引力有限。

对Agent生态的影响,我觉得短期内可能有限,但长期来看,如果阿里云能够持续投入,并逐步开放生态,还是很有潜力的。

千问的优势在于中文语境下的理解能力。毕竟是国内团队开发的模型,在处理中文文本和对话方面肯定更胜一筹。不足之处可能在于模型的通用性和泛化能力,需要不断迭代和优化。

作为一个小白,我肯定选无影云电脑!轻量应用服务器听起来就让人头大,还要自己配置这配置那的,太麻烦了。无影云电脑直接装好了一切,点开就能用,省时省力。而且,阿里云的无影云电脑性能应该挺不错的,运行Agent应用应该没问题。当然,如果预算有限,或者对服务器配置比较熟悉,也可以考虑轻量应用服务器。但对于我来说,简单易用才是王道!

从技术角度分析,集成不同的消息通道涉及到API对接、消息格式转换、用户身份验证等多个方面的问题。Moltbot需要提供一个灵活的消息适配器,能够支持不同的消息协议和数据格式。此外,还需要考虑消息的安全性、可靠性和实时性。例如,如何防止恶意消息攻击,如何保证消息的送达率,如何实现消息的实时推送等。未来,随着5G和边缘计算技术的发展,Moltbot可以在边缘节点部署消息处理模块,进一步提升消息的传输速度和处理效率。

另外,还需要关注各个平台的开放程度和政策限制。有些平台可能限制第三方应用的接入,或者对消息内容进行审查。Moltbot需要遵守相关规定,避免触犯法律法规。

从资源利用的角度来看,如果只是个人学习或小型项目,轻量应用服务器的性价比可能更高,可以根据实际使用情况灵活调整配置。而无影云电脑更适合团队协作或需要高配置的场景,例如运行复杂的Agent应用或需要GPU加速的任务。此外,还需要考虑数据安全和网络延迟等因素。轻量应用服务器的数据存储在云端服务器上,需要自行负责数据备份和安全防护。无影云电脑则提供了更完善的安全保障,但可能会受到网络延迟的影响。

总之,选择哪种部署方式需要综合考虑自身的技术水平、项目需求、预算以及对数据安全和网络延迟的要求。

这个问题很有意思!Moltbot支持iMessage和钉钉,这已经很不错了,覆盖了办公和一部分个人用户的需求。但如果想要进一步扩大用户群体,集成微信是必不可少的。毕竟,微信在国内的普及率太高了,几乎人人都用。想象一下,直接在微信里和你的Agent对话,获取信息、完成任务,简直太方便了。除了微信,还可以考虑集成企业微信、飞书等办公平台,或者Telegram、WhatsApp等海外社交平台。

当然,集成不同的消息通道需要考虑不同的技术实现和政策风险。例如,微信的API接口相对封闭,接入难度较大。此外,还需要遵守各个平台的规则和协议,避免违规行为。但总的来说,扩展消息通道是Moltbot发展的必然趋势,也是提升用户体验的关键一步。

微信?我觉得有点悬。微信的生态比较封闭,不太可能轻易开放API给第三方应用。不过,钉钉的潜力还是很大的,毕竟阿里云和钉钉是兄弟公司,合作起来肯定更方便。说不定以后可以直接用钉钉的群机器人来控制Moltbot,实现多人协作。除了钉钉,我觉得企业微信也是一个不错的选择,可以帮助企业构建智能化的办公平台。当然,最终还是要看阿里云的战略规划和技术实力了。

从技术角度分析,集成千问模型为Agent开发者提供了开箱即用的AI能力,降低了初期研发成本和技术门槛。开发者无需自行训练或部署大模型,可以直接利用阿里云提供的API进行调用,专注于Agent的逻辑设计和功能实现。未来,Moltbot支持其他大模型平台的关键在于其架构的开放性和可扩展性。如果Moltbot采用了模块化设计,并提供了标准的API接口,那么集成其他大模型平台在技术上是可行的。此外,还需要考虑不同大模型平台的兼容性、性能差异以及授权许可等问题。